GLUTEN-FREE CORNBREAD



Gluten-Free Cornbread image

Easy gluten-free cornbread. Savory, not sweet. Includes dairy-free option.

Provided by Elizabeth

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 1/2 cups coarse/medium ground gluten-free cornmeal (see note) ((8 ounces; 226 grams))
1/2 cup gluten-free flour, see note ((2 1/2 ounces; 70 grams))
2 tablespoons granulated sugar ((1 ounce; 28 grams))
1 tablespo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up milk, see note for dairy-free option ((6 ounces; 170 grams))
2 large eggs ((about 4 ounces out of shell; 114 grams))
1/3 cup vegetable oil ((2 1/3 ounces; 66 grams))

Steps:

  • Heat oven. Preheat oven to 425 degrees F. (If using an 8-inch cast iron skillet, place into oven before preheating. Heat skillet for at least 10 minutes.)
  • Prepare the batter. Whisk together gluten-free cornmeal, flour, sugar, baking powder, salt, and baking soda in a large bowl. Add the milk, eggs, and oil. Whisk until combined. Batter should look almost smooth. A few lumps remaining is normal.
  • Bake. If using a skillet, remove skillet from oven and place on a heatproof surface. Grease with nonstick cooking spray or brush generously with vegetable oil.If using an 8-inch round cake pan, grease the pan lightly with nonstick cooking spray. Pour batter into pan. Bake until set, about 15 minutes. The cornbread should spring back when touched.
  • Cool and serve. Allow cornbread to cool for about five minutes before cutting into pieces.
  • Store. Wrap cornbread and store on the counter overnight. Or cool thoroughly, wrap tightly, and freeze for up to two months. Allow cornbread to thaw on the counter.

GLUTEN-FREE OATMEAL CORNBREAD



Gluten-Free Oatmeal Cornbread image

Provided by Eating Healthy Spending Less

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 1/2 cup cornmeal
1 1/2 cup oat flour (grind oats into a flour)
1 1/2 cup water
1/4 cup pure maple syrup
3 Tbsp. flaxseed meal (or 1 egg)
1 tsp. baking soda
1/2 tsp. salt

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ees, and grease a loaf pan.
  • Whisk all ingredients together and pour into loaf pan.
  • Let cornbread dough rest for 5 minutes before putting in the oven. This allows the oats to absorb some liquid.
  •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until gold brown around the edges and the center feels firm.
  • If you want to make these into muffins, set your oven to 350 degrees and bake for 18-20 minutes.

RUSTIC OATMEAL CORNBREAD



Rustic Oatmeal Cornbread image

Are you looking for something different in making cornbread? This adds a nutty, rustic flavor to traditional southern cornbread. The recipe is adapted from one appearing in the Fort Worth Star Telegram newspaper by Amy Culbertson.

Provided by Susie D

Categories     Quick Breads

Time 25m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 cup yellow cornmeal
1/2 cup oatmeal (not instant)
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
2 eggs, beaten
1/4 cup margarine or 1/4 cup butter, melted
1/2 cup milk
1 tablespoon sugar (optional)

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 450 degrees.
  • Mix together dry ingredients.
  • Stir in beaten eggs, butter, & milk.
  • Add enough additional butter or oil to cover the bottom of a 9 or 10 inch cast iron skillet and place pan in hot oven.
  • When the pan is very hot, remove from the oven & pour the cornbread batter into the skillet.
  • Return to oven & bake approximately 15 minutes until browned.
  • Cut into wedges to serve.

A BOWL OF GLUTEN-FREE OATMEAL



A Bowl of Gluten-Free Oatmeal image

When I was first diagnosed with celiac, I didn't miss most of the gluten. But a bowl of warm oatmeal? I longed for that. You see, until a few years ago, there were no gluten-free oats available on the market. Oats themselves are naturally gluten-free. However, since they are usually grown side-by-side with wheat, transported in the same truck as wheat, and manufactured on the production lines as wheat, the cross-contamination of typical oats make them not gluten-free. However, the good news is that companies like Bob's Red Mill now sell certified gluten-free oats. Oatmeal, you're back!

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 cup whole milk
1 cup water
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up whole rolled gluten-free oats

Steps:

  • Set a saucepan over high heat. Pour in the milk and water. Add the salt and vanilla extract. Bring the liquids to a boil.
  • When the milky water is boiling, pour in the oats. Stir quite vigorously. When the water returns to a boil, turn down the heat to low. Simmer the oats, stirring every few minutes, until the oats are creamy and plump, the liquid fully absorbed, about 15 minutes.
  • Turn off the heat and cover the pan. Let the oatmeal sit for five minutes to fully absorb the liquid.
  • Top with your favorite sweetener and fruit. (This one is maple syrup, peaches, and blackberries.)
  • Variations: If you cannot eat dairy, almond milk or hemp milk work well here too.
  • If you have a fresh vanilla bean, scrape the insides of it into the pot instead of vanilla extract. This will be the best oatmeal you have ever eaten.
